Activists in forest next to car producer VDL Nedcar are provided with food

The activists of Save the Sterrebos said this morning they were sitting in the trees without food or drink. “Our forest defenders have been in the tree in #Sterrebos for more than 24 hours and we are not allowed to bring them food or drink.” The club called on the mayor of Sittard, Hans Verheijen, to allow the declaration of food and drinks.

The council says it will do the same. Agreements are made with the activists for this purpose. “We will also monitor those agreements. It is not the intention that people come to the Sterrebos out of free consideration and bring food and drinks. The activists are still on private property. People have nothing to do there,” the municipality writes. a press release.

In front of a road that leads to the forest is a sign with ‘No Trespassing’. A police spokesman confirms that officers do indeed stop anyone who wants to enter the forest.

Seven activists arrested

In the night from Friday to Saturday, the police arrested seven activists at the Sterrebos in Limburg. During the day on Friday, three people were also arrested around the Sterrebos. They have since been released.

The activists went early yesterday to occupy the forest to prevent felling. They want to prevent seven hectares of the Sterrebos from disappearing to enable expansion of the production halls of car manufacturer VDL Nedcar.

Forest owned by VDL

The activists say they will only leave if they receive a guarantee that the forest will not be cut down. The forest is owned by VDL and not open to the public. Yesterday sympathizers were still allowed to bring food and drinks to them, but afterwards they were also denied access by the police and enforcers of the municipality of Sittard-Geleen.
